What are Special Foundations?
Special foundations are systems designed to transfer a structure's loads to the ground when surface solutions, such as footings or slabs, are not technically or economically feasible. Their use is imperative in complex geotechnical conditions.
Main Applications:
- Low quality soils: Soft, expansive or liquefaction risk soils.
- High structural loads: Skyscrapers, bridges or large infrastructures.
- Limited space: Works in urban centers where extensive excavations are impossible.
- Presence of water: Foundations below the water table requiring hydraulic control.
- Reinforcement of existing structures: Settlement rehabilitation, expansion or correction projects.
Two of the most versatile and efficient solutions in modern engineering are micropiles and pile walls.

Key Types: Micropiles and Pile Walls
Micropiles: The Precise Solution for Complex Terrains
The micropiles They are deep foundation elements with a small diameter (generally between 100 and 300 mm). The construction process consists of drilling into the ground, installing a steel frame, and injecting cement grout under pressure. Their function is to transfer loads to deeper, more capable soil strata.
Advantages and Technical Features:
- Versatility: Ideal for reinforcements, underpinnings and foundations in hard-to-reach spaces.
- Low Impact: The drilling rigs are compact and generate minimal vibrations, protecting adjacent structures.
- Adaptability: They comply with international regulations such as EN 14199 and Eurocodes, ensuring a reliable design.
- Loading capacity: They can reach capacities of 200 to 800 kN per unit, depending on the design and terrain.
Pile Walls: Containment and Stability
The pile walls Diaphragm walls (or sluice walls) are retaining structures formed by a succession of contiguous or intersecting perforated piles or micropiles. Their main purpose is to withstand the lateral thrust of the ground and water, making them crucial in deep excavations.
Main Uses:
- Construction of basements and underground parking in urban areas.
- Creation of impermeable barriers to control the water table.
- Foundation and containment in large infrastructure projects such as tunnels or metro stations.
